Growth Drivers: Electrification, Automation, and Medical Precision

Three structural demand drivers are reshaping the market:

  1. Electrification of Mobility
    Electric vehicles are significantly increasing motor content per vehicle. Micro motors power everything from HVAC systems and seat adjustments to battery thermal management and ADAS components. As EV architectures evolve, the number of motors per unit—and their performance requirements—continues to rise.
  2. Industrial Automation Acceleration
    Factory automation investments across Asia Pacific—particularly in India, South Korea, and China—are fueling demand for micro motors in robotics, conveyors, and precision control systems. Government-backed Industry 4.0 programs are accelerating adoption at scale.
  3. Medical Device Complexity
    The shift toward minimally invasive procedures and robotic-assisted surgery is driving demand for compact, high-precision, and highly reliable brushless micro motors. Compliance requirements such as ISO 13485 and cleanroom manufacturing are elevating barriers to entry while increasing margins.

Segmentation Insights: DC Dominance, Brushless Momentum

By Product Type
DC micro motors remain dominant due to cost efficiency, simplicity, and wide applicability. Their projected CAGR of ~5.5% reflects sustained demand across automotive and electronics.

By Technology
Brushed motors continue to lead in volume due to cost advantages. However, brushless motors—growing at ~6.2% CAGR—are gaining traction in high-performance applications due to superior efficiency, durability, and lower maintenance.

By Power Consumption
The >48V segment is emerging as a high-growth category, particularly in EVs and industrial automation, where higher power and performance are essential.

By Application
Automotive leads with a 32% share and the highest growth trajectory (~7.8% CAGR), followed by industrial automation and medical equipment.

Regional Analysis: Asia Pacific Leads, India Emerges as Growth Engine

Asia Pacific remains the epicenter of growth, driven by manufacturing scale, EV adoption, and automation investments.

  • China (6.8% CAGR): Dominates production and consumption, supported by “Made in China 2025”
  • India (6.4% CAGR): Rapidly expanding automotive and automation sectors, bolstered by “Make in India” and EV policies
  • South Korea & Japan: Strong in electronics, robotics, and precision manufacturing

North America and Europe continue to lead in innovation, regulatory frameworks, and high-value applications, particularly in healthcare and advanced manufacturing.
